Salary overview

Median pay for this occupation in North Carolina is $39,910 a year, trailing the national median of $44,860 by 11.0%. Half of workers earn between $32,750 and $46,700. Beyond that band, the tenth percentile sits at $26,490 and the ninetieth at $61,340.

The area has 31,810 jobs in this occupation, which works out to 6.4 of every thousand jobs. Among the 51 states with published data for this occupation, North Carolina ranks 44th by median wage. Pinehurst leads the state's metro areas for this occupation, at $46,600. Set against every other occupation measured in the same area, it ranks 608th of 745 by median pay.

What the pay is worth locally

Prices in North Carolina run 5.7% below the national average, so the median of $39,910 goes as far as $42,322 would elsewhere in the country. Measured that way it compares to the national median at 5.7% below the national median in real terms.
